      柯林斯词典

        The adjective is pronounced /'peɪsti/. The noun is pronounced /'pæsti/. 形容词读作/'peɪsti/。名词读作/'pæsti/。

      • ADJ-GRADED 脸色苍白的
        If you arepastyor if you have apastyface, you look pale and unhealthy.
        1. My complexion remained pale and pasty...
          我的脸色依旧苍白。
        2. Ron Freeman appeared pasty faced and nervous.
          罗恩·弗里曼脸色苍白,显得很紧张。
